At 733 PM CDT, Doppler radar was tracking a strong thunderstorm over Thompson, or 7 miles south of Grand Forks, moving southeast at 35 mph. HAZARD...Wind gusts up to 50 mph and nickel size hail. SOURCE...Radar indicated. IMPACT...Gusty winds could knock down tree limbs and blow around unsecured objects. Minor hail damage to vegetation is possible. Locations impacted include... Thompson, Climax, Merrifield, Eldred, and Bygland. This includes Interstate 29 between mile markers 123 and 136. P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S... If outdoors, consider seeking shelter inside a building.
